Wie erzwinge ich A2DP-Sink, wenn ein drahtloses Bluetooth-Headset angeschlossen ist?

Wie erzwinge ich A2DP-Sink, wenn ein drahtloses Bluetooth-Headset angeschlossen ist?

Auf meinem PC ist Debian 9 Stretch installiert, aber wenn ich Musik hören möchte, ist sie nicht gut zu hören. Ich habe in den Audioeinstellungen festgestellt, dass das A2DP-Profil vorhanden ist, aber wenn ich es auswähle, passiert nichts. Es gibt eine Möglichkeit, die A2DP-Verbindung zu erzwingen, wenn das Headset an den PC angeschlossen ist. Ich habe es übrigens bereits gekoppelt.

Hilfe wird geschätzt. Danke.

Antwort1

Ich verwende ein SoundBuds Curve-Headset unter Debian 9 und hatte dasselbe Problem: Ich konnte nicht vom HSP/HFP-Profil zum A2DP-Profil wechseln.

Das Problem wurde für mich durch das Bearbeiten behoben /etc/bluetooth/main.conf.

Fügen Sie zunächst die folgenden Zeilen unter dem Tag [General] hinzu (kopiert aus audio.conf):

# Automatically connect both A2DP and HFP/HSP profiles for incoming
# connections. Some headsets that support both profiles will only connect the
# other one automatically so the default setting of true is usually a good
# idea.
AutoConnect=true

Aktivieren Sie als Nächstes die Unterstützung für mehrere Profile. Diese finden Sie ein paar Zeilen weiter unten in main.conf:

# Enables Multi Profile Specification support. This allows to specify if
# system supports only Multiple Profiles Single Device (MPSD) configuration
# or both Multiple Profiles Single Device (MPSD) and Multiple Profiles Multiple
# Devices (MPMD) configurations.
# Possible values: "off", "single", "multiple"
MultiProfile = multiple

Antwort2

Ich hatte auch Probleme mit den Soundbuds Curve und meinem MBP mit MacOS Mojave. Die Verbindung funktioniert einwandfrei, aber es gibt Probleme beim Zurückschalten vom „Headset“-Modus/HSP|HFP in den „Musik“-Modus/A2DP. Ich betreibe mehrere Virtualbox-Maschinen über Vagrant für meine Entwicklungsaufgaben. Ich erwähne das nur, weil ich vorher eine App namens Oversight verwendet habe, die im Grunde zwischen Ihren Kamera- und Mikrofongeräten und dem Betriebssystem saß und Sie warnte, wenn etwas versuchte, darauf zuzugreifen. Mir ist aufgefallen, dass das Starten von Debian-VMs das Mikrofon auslöste, was bei meinem speziellen Problem eine Rolle spielen könnte. Ich bin auf diesen Artikel gestoßen, vielleicht gibt es einige Parallelen zu Debian?

Auch andere Konfigurationsprobleme können AptX-Audio deaktivieren. Wie Darko.Audio erklärt, greift macOS auf einem Mac auf SBC-Audio in geringerer Qualität zurück, wenn Sie 2,4-GHz-WLAN verwenden, mehr als zwei Bluetooth-Geräte an einen Desktop angeschlossen haben oder mehr als eines an einen Laptop angeschlossen ist, wenn Sie die Bluetooth Advanced Audio Distribution Profile (A2DP)-Verbindung verwenden. Das ist Apples Meinung.

...

Technisch gesehen verwenden die Kopfhörer das Bluetooth-Profil A2DP, wenn Sie sie nur als Tonausgabegerät verwenden, und idealerweise AptX für maximale Klangqualität. Wenn Sie das Mikrofon benötigen, verwenden sie das Headset-Profil oder das Freisprechprofil (HSP oder HFP). Dies ermöglicht sowohl die Aufnahme über das Mikrofon als auch die Wiedergabe über die Kopfhörer, aber die Klangqualität der Kopfhörer ist bei Verwendung von HSP oder HFP schrecklich.

Referenz:Warum Bluetooth-Headsets auf Windows-PCs schrecklich sind

verwandte Informationen